A Flame Spray Gun is a thermal spraying tool used to melt wire or powder material and apply it as a coating onto a metal surface. It's the equipment behind zinc metalizing, corrosion protection coatings, and the repair of worn or damaged machine parts, without heating the base metal enough to warp or weaken it.

A flame spray gun uses a combustion flame, usually oxygen and acetylene, LPG, or propane, to melt a coating material fed into the gun as wire or powder. Once melted, the material is atomized with compressed air and sprayed onto the surface, where it solidifies almost immediately as a coating.
This process is often called a "cold process," even though it uses a flame, because the base metal stays relatively cool during application. That's what makes it useful for repair work and coating parts that can't handle heavy heat input without distorting or losing their properties. Wire flame spray guns work well on both ferrous and non-ferrous metals, and powder flame spray guns handle materials that are harder to feed in wire form, like ceramics and certain metal alloys.
